For the problem with wrong movie thumbs make sure that the settings on your source not has "extract thumbs" option enabled.

Then you should delete all the thumbs cahce as xbmc stores all cached thumbs
in your userdata/thumbnails folder. just delete everything under the thumbnails folder. for good measure you can also completely delete your myvideos.db file
under userdata\database

Then make a complete new libraryscan of your movie source.

Got it working.
I have a feeling it's a total /facepalm moment, but my friend did the exact same thing as me and had the same issues so perhaps not.

When adding the network location to xbmc, I added it manually (typing it in rather than browsing) like so:
\\servername\sharedirectory
or: \\servername\sharedirectory\

xbmc decided it was actually:
\\servername\sharedirectory/

and that seemed to cause the library issues.

Instead, I added the location as a samba share in xbmc by browsing to it:
smb://servername/movies/

And then choosing that as a location to add to the library.
It scanned and worked. Hooray!

I removed the location and started over, testing both methods to make sure, and the same thing happened again. The SMB source was successful while the other fails in library mode.

Other differences include:
- movie information correctly working for the SMB source items (nothing happens when clicked with the manually added source)
- movies correctly removed from the library for the SMB source (they're not removed with the manual source for some reason, even if I clean the library)
